2. What is PSE Timber?

What is PSE Timber
Caption: PSE Timber is known for its smooth, planed surface and square edges.

PSE Timber stands for Planed Square Edge Timber. It is a type of timber that has been planed on all four sides to create a smooth, finished surface. The edges are squared off, making it easier to work with and providing a clean, professional look. PSE Timber is commonly used in construction, furniture making, and DIY projects.


3. The Manufacturing Process of PSE Timber

Manufacturing Process
Caption: The manufacturing process of PSE Timber involves several stages, from logging to planing.

The production of PSE Timber involves several key steps:

  1. Logging: Trees are harvested and transported to a sawmill.
  2. Sawing: The logs are cut into rough-sawn timber.
  3. Drying: The timber is dried to reduce moisture content, either through air drying or kiln drying.
  4. Planing: The timber is planed on all four sides to create a smooth, finished surface.
  5. Squaring Edges: The edges are squared off to ensure uniformity.
  6. Quality Control: The timber is inspected for defects and graded according to quality standards.

4. Types of PSE Timber

Types of PSE Timber
Caption: PSE Timber comes in various types, each suited for different applications.

PSE Timber is available in several types, including:

  • Softwood PSE Timber: Commonly used in construction, fencing, and decking.
  • Hardwood PSE Timber: Ideal for furniture making and high-end woodworking projects.
  • Treated PSE Timber: Treated with preservatives to enhance durability and resistance to pests and rot.
  • Untreated PSE Timber: Used for indoor applications where treatment is not necessary.

7. Disadvantages of PSE Timber

Disadvantages of PSE Timber
Caption: Despite its many benefits, PSE Timber has some drawbacks.

Some potential disadvantages of PSE Timber include:

  • Cost: PSE Timber can be more expensive than rough-sawn timber.
  • Limited Availability: Certain types of PSE Timber may not be readily available in all areas.
  • Susceptibility to Warping: If not properly dried, PSE Timber can warp over time.
  • Maintenance: Untreated PSE Timber may require regular maintenance to prevent decay.

11. Frequently Asked Questions (FAQs)

Q1: What does PSE stand for in PSE Timber?

A: PSE stands for Planed Square Edge, referring to the smooth, planed surface and squared edges of the timber.

Q2: Can PSE Timber be used outdoors?

A: Yes, PSE Timber can be used outdoors, especially if it is treated to resist moisture, pests, and rot.

Q3: How does PSE Timber differ from rough-sawn timber?

A: PSE Timber is planed on all four sides, giving it a smooth finish and squared edges, whereas rough-sawn timber has a rough, unfinished surface.

Q4: Is PSE Timber more expensive than rough-sawn timber?

A: Yes, PSE Timber is generally more expensive due to the additional processing involved in planing and squaring the edges.
